I'm currently working on a project that monitors a production/manufacturing system. In the system there are 10 processes involved and each process have a controller with red green and yellow buttons and also a sensor to determine the number of outputs for each process. Each button corresponds to a certain problem and when pressed, it will be displayed to a central display that will be visible to the supervisors. I am planning to use Arduino ESP8266 for each controller and a raspberry pi for the main server (display TV) for them to communicate through a single router. I will be using c# to display the data received from each ESP8266. I would just like to ask if this would be the best approach for the requirement.
